The Real Cost

Average net price after aid, grouped by household income.

Net price after aid

Kent State University at East Liverpool cost by family income

These are the average out-of-pocket costs after grants and scholarships, based on U.S. Department of Education reporting.

Family income $0 - $30,000 $7,312/yr
Family income $30,001 - $48,000 $9,383/yr
Family income $48,001 - $75,000 $11,325/yr
Family income $75,001 - $110,000 $13,776/yr

Low-income families under $30k pay an average of $7,312 per year. This band often benefits most from Pell Grants and institutional aid.

Scholarships and Grants at Kent State University at East Liverpool

Kent State University at East Liverpool participates in federal financial aid programs. The data below is sourced from the U.S. Department of Education and reflects the most recently available award year. Students should contact the financial aid office directly for current scholarship opportunities, institutional grants, and merit-based awards.

Pell Grant Rate 23.8% of students
Federal Loan Rate 32.9% of students
Avg Net Price $10,569 after aid
Median Debt $24,500 completers
